Hix #2 is a privately owned dam located in Jones, South Dakota, along a tributary of the White River.
This earth dam stands at 26 feet in height and spans 360 feet in length, with a storage capacity of 51 acre-feet. Completed in 1959, the dam is regulated by the South Dakota Department of Environment and Natural Resources, with state permitting, inspection, and enforcement in place to ensure compliance and safety.
Although classified as having a low hazard potential, the condition assessment of Hix #2 has not been rated. Emergency action preparedness, including the development of an Emergency Action Plan, has not been reported. With no identified risk management measures in place, there is a need for further evaluation and planning to address any potential risks associated with the dam.
